Understanding the Importance of Prompt Optimization
Prompt optimization involves designing questions or commands that guide AI models to produce more relevant and precise outputs. Well-crafted prompts reduce ambiguity, improve response accuracy, and save time during the development process.
Tips for Enhancing Your Prompts
1. Be Clear and Specific
Avoid vague language. Instead of asking, “Tell me about history,” specify the topic, such as “Provide a summary of the causes of the French Revolution.”
2. Use Contextual Information
Providing background details helps the AI understand your intent better. For example, “As a history teacher, explain the significance of the Treaty of Versailles.”
3. Limit the Scope
Focusing on a specific aspect yields more targeted responses. Instead of “Discuss World War II,” ask “What were the main strategies used by the Allies in the European theater?”
4. Use Proper Formatting and Keywords
Incorporate relevant keywords and formatting cues, such as “List,” “Explain,” or “Compare,” to guide the AI’s response style.
Additional Strategies for Prompt Optimization
5. Experiment and Iterate
Refine prompts based on the responses received. Adjust wording and scope to improve output quality over time.
6. Use Examples
Providing examples within your prompt can clarify your expectations. For example, “Give an example of a medieval trade route, like the Silk Road.”
7. Avoid Ambiguity
Ensure your prompts do not contain ambiguous language that could lead to varied interpretations.
